Coyote Canyon School, part of the Bullhead City School District, is a specialized special education school in Arizona dedicated to supporting students with language-based learning disabilities and twice-exceptional learners. Serving grades from preschool through eighth grade, the school fosters an inclusive environment where tailored educational experiences empower students to thrive academically and socially. The institution focuses on providing individualized attention to ensure every child receives the specific resources needed to succeed.
The school distinguishes itself through its commitment to a low student-teacher ratio, which enhances personalized instruction and strengthens partnerships between educators and families. Specialized facilities are available to cater to various developmental needs, while community events promote engagement and support among parents. This holistic approach creates a vibrant learning community designed to help each student flourish.
Academic programs at Coyote Canyon School include comprehensive support for Individualized Education Programs (IEPs), special needs support, therapeutic services, and developmental assistance.
